Both foods compared at 100 kcal.

The verdict

Basil, fresh comes out ahead, winning 5 of 9 nutrient match-ups.

Pick Basil, fresh for more protein, less saturated fat, more potassium, more magnesium and more vitamin C.

Pick Savory, ground for more fiber, less sodium, more calcium and more iron.
